As of Bug 1658242, the new account-ecosystem ping is on by default in nightly, off by default on other channels. This bug tracks the removal of that per-channel logic in favour of defaulting toolkit.telemetry.ecosystemtelemetry.enabled to true on all channels.

I want to get another couple of days of data from the validation work in Bug 1635667 before we do this, to be confident the ping is working as intended.

We have not observed any new bugs or stability issues with FxA or Sync on Nightly while this has been active.
